Help your team feel confident with the tools and the numbers.
Great strategies and campaigns only go so far if your team doesn’t feel comfortable using the platforms behind them.
Our Digital Training services are designed to build confidence and capability across your team — from hands-on specialists to senior stakeholders who just want to understand what they’re looking at.
We provide bespoke corporate training, occasional public courses (announced on our socials), and one-to-one consultancy across tools like Google Tag Manager, Google Analytics 4, Google Ads, Looker Studio and SEO.
Everything is practical, friendly and rooted in real-world use, not theory.

Training is focused on building skills and understanding – teaching your team how to work with the tools and data. Consultancy and ongoing support are more about us doing the work with or for you (e.g. setting up tracking, building dashboards, managing campaigns). Many clients choose a mix of both.
Both. We’re happy to run sessions on-site with your team, fully remote over video, or a blend of the two. For remote sessions, we keep things interactive with Q&A, live demos and practical exercises rather than long lectures.
